On Thursday, former Illinois Republican nominee Darren Bailey launched his second campaign for the governor's office, to once again challenge Gov. J.B. Pritzker.

The southern Illinois farmer and former state senator announced his candidacy in a social media post.

Bailey is from Xenia, located northeast of Mt. Vernon. He was elected to the Illinois General Assembly in 2019 and claimed a state senate seat in 2020. He won the Republican gubernatorial nomination in 2022.

Bailey has always positioned himself as an ally of President Trump, and gained recognition during the COVID pandemic in 2020 after he filed a lawsuit against Pritzker's “stay-at-home” order.

He was also a critic of Pritzker’s role in getting the “SAFE-T Act” passed.
